Output 8ae506594289f053e26cd6e9f92a295593793523bee1a9108529159ef456d413:4

value
2472867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9ddc2d861213ce5a55b6d51cf7b2b2857f046b9 OP_EQUAL
address
3L6PQLKrK1Tso731igqieYi2Cw5b3Qfeq3
transaction
8ae506594289f053e26cd6e9f92a295593793523bee1a9108529159ef456d413
confirmations
119585
spent
true